Dryer vent length is one of the most overlooked factors in laundry room safety and performance. Many homeowners assume that as long as the dryer is vented outside, distance does not matter much. This often leads to problems when vents run too far, include too many turns, or are routed through areas that slow airflow. The question how far can dryer vent run usually comes up after clothes start taking longer to dry, the laundry room feels unusually warm, or lint buildup becomes noticeable. Understanding why vent length matters helps homeowners avoid fire risks, moisture problems, and unnecessary wear on their dryer.
Why Dryer Vent Length Has Limits
Every dryer pushes hot, moist air through a vent using an internal blower. That blower has limited power. The farther the air must travel, the harder the dryer has to work to move it. As vent length increases, airflow slows and lint begins to settle inside the duct. Moisture also lingers longer, which increases humidity inside the vent system.
When homeowners ask how far can dryer vent run, the real concern is whether the dryer can move air efficiently over that distance. Long vent runs increase resistance and make it easier for lint to collect. This combination reduces performance and increases fire risk over time.
Manufacturer Guidelines Set the Baseline
Dryer manufacturers provide maximum vent length guidelines for each model. These guidelines assume proper materials and minimal bends. While exact limits vary, many dryers allow a maximum straight run of around twenty five to thirty five feet under ideal conditions.
These numbers are not suggestions. They reflect how far the dryer can move air safely and effectively. When vent systems exceed manufacturer limits, performance drops and the risk of overheating increases. Understanding how far can dryer vent run starts with respecting these manufacturer recommendations.
Why Bends Reduce Allowed Vent Length
Every bend or turn in a dryer vent reduces airflow. Sharp turns slow the movement of air and create areas where lint settles. Because of this, manufacturers reduce the maximum allowable vent length for each elbow or bend in the system.
A vent with multiple turns may need to be much shorter than a straight run to perform safely. This is why two homes with the same distance to the exterior may have very different vent performance. The number of turns often matters more than total distance when evaluating how far can dryer vent run.
Vertical Runs Add Extra Resistance
Dryer vents that run upward add another layer of resistance. Gravity works against the movement of lint and moisture, increasing the chance that debris settles inside the duct. Vertical sections also tend to cool faster, which can lead to condensation.
This does not mean vertical venting is unsafe by default. It means vent length limits become even more important. Short, well designed vertical runs perform better than long horizontal systems with poor routing. Homeowners asking how far can dryer vent run should consider direction as well as distance.
Material Choice Impacts Maximum Distance
Vent material plays a major role in airflow efficiency. Smooth metal ducts allow air and lint to move freely. Flexible or ribbed ducts create friction that traps lint and slows airflow.
Long vent runs require rigid or semi rigid metal ducting to perform safely. Using flexible materials in long runs significantly reduces effective vent length. Many dryer vent problems traced to distance issues actually stem from poor material choice rather than distance alone.
Why Flexible Ducts Shorten Safe Vent Length
Flexible ducts sag over time, creating low points where lint and moisture collect. These pockets restrict airflow and increase fire risk. Even short runs perform poorly when flexible materials are used improperly.
Homeowners often ask how far can dryer vent run after replacing a dryer or rearranging a laundry room. In many cases, the issue is not distance but the use of flexible ducting that reduces airflow far more than expected.
Moisture and Condensation in Long Vent Runs
Dryers release a large amount of moisture with every load. In long vent systems, that moisture may not exit quickly. As warm air cools inside the duct, condensation forms. Moisture mixes with lint and creates sticky buildup that adheres to duct walls.
This buildup narrows the vent pathway and accelerates clogging. Over time, drying cycles become longer and the dryer works harder. Moisture issues often lead homeowners to reconsider how far can dryer vent run safely in their home.
Lint Accumulation and Fire Risk
Lint is highly flammable. The U.S. Consumer Product Safety Commission reports that clogged dryer vents contribute to thousands of residential fires each year. Long vent runs increase the surface area where lint can collect.
As lint builds up, airflow decreases further, creating a cycle of increasing risk. This is why vent length limits exist. Understanding how far can dryer vent run helps homeowners reduce fire hazards before they develop.
Exterior Termination Still Affects Performance
Where the vent exits the home matters just as much as how far it runs. Blocked or restrictive vent hoods reduce airflow and worsen the effects of long vent runs. Screens and improper covers trap lint and should be avoided.
Exterior termination points must remain clear and accessible. A well designed vent run still fails if the exit becomes clogged. Many dryer vent issues blamed on distance are actually caused by blocked terminations.
Building Codes and Vent Length
Building codes often reference manufacturer guidelines when setting vent length limits. Codes also specify acceptable materials and installation methods. These rules exist to reduce fire risk and ensure proper dryer performance.
The U.S. Department of Energy emphasizes efficient venting as part of overall appliance safety. Following both code and manufacturer limits ensures dryer vents operate as intended.

Maintenance Becomes More Important With Long Runs
Longer dryer vents require more frequent inspection and cleaning. Lint accumulation happens gradually and often goes unnoticed until performance drops. Regular maintenance removes buildup before it becomes hazardous.
Homes with extended vent systems benefit from scheduled cleaning to keep airflow strong. Preventive maintenance helps dryers operate efficiently and safely over time.
Warning Signs a Vent Run Is Too Long
Clothes taking longer to dry, excessive heat in the laundry area, burning smells, or damp clothing all signal vent problems. These symptoms often appear when vent length exceeds safe limits or airflow is restricted.
When these signs occur, homeowners often revisit the question how far can dryer vent run. In many cases, shortening or improving the vent system resolves the issue.
